
Hinds announce third LP with anthemic lead cut "Good Bad Times"
Spanish four-piece Hinds are back with news of their third album The Prettiest Curse, which is previewed with the opening anthem "Good Bad Times".
"Good Bad Times" arrives after previous single "Riding Solo", which dropped in December 2019, and will also feature on their new album.
Hinds' Carlotta Cosials says of "Good Bad Times", "You know that part in the movies when two people on a relationship are living complete opposite realities? When one thinks everything is great and the other one is about to drown? "Good Bad Times" is the struggle of communication, time difference, distance. Like the two sides of a coin. Two sides close together that can’t be separated, even though they seem to be completely different."
The Prettiest Curse will be Hinds' first album since 2018's I Don't Run.
